How does a coleman lantern generator work?

How does a coleman lantern generator work? The generator is a hollow brass tube where our gasoline or kerosene is heated to point where it turns to vapor. The end of the generator, called the gas tip, has a very small hole that shoots the gas vapor into the lantern’s burner.

How does Coleman stove generator work? The flame will burn yellow until the generator (the pipe running across the burner) gets hot enough to vaporize the fuel reliably. Once the flame becomes blue instead of yellow, turn the wire lever so it points downward. This causes the tank to feed 100% liquid fuel into the generator tube.

Can you clean the generator on a Coleman lantern? if there is still no fuel flow, try cleaning the tip of the generator. If you lantern has a tip-cleaning lever, turn it clockwise three or four times and leave it in the down position. If your lantern does not have a tip cleaning lever, turn the knob from off to on three or four times.

Is a lantern fish real?

Lanternfishes (or myctophids, from the Greek μυκτήρ myktḗr, “nose” and ophis, “serpent”) are small mesopelagic fish of the large family Myctophidae. One of two families in the order Myctophiformes, the Myctophidae are represented by 246 species in 33 genera, and are found in oceans worldwide.

How do you celebrate Lantern Festival?

On the night of the Chinese Lantern Festival, streets are decorated with colorful lanterns, often with riddles written on them. People eat sweet rice balls called tangyuan, watch dragon and lion dances, and set off fireworks.

How much damage did Hurricane Andrew Cause in Florida?

Overall, Andrew caused $25.3 billion (1992 USD) in damage and 44 fatalities in the state of Florida alone. However, other estimates report that Andrew created $32 billion in overall damage. Of the 44 deaths, 15 were direct fatalities, while 29 were indirectly caused by the storm.
